‘Also win WAFU trophy’ — Dare hails Flying Eagles over AFCON qualification | TheCable

Sunday Dare, minister of youth and sports development, on Wednesday, congratulated the national U-20 team for qualifying for the final of the WAFU U-20 Championship in Niamey, Niger Republic.Cote d’Ivoire 2-1 after extra time on Tuesday evening in a tightly contested semi-final encounter to book a place in Saturday’s final as well as qualify for the CAF U-20 Africa Cup of Nations in Egypt in 2023.

“Your hard-earned victory over Cote d’Ivoire in the semi-final and your performances in the earlier games against Ghana and Burkina Faso have shown what is possible when a team plays with focus, determination and discipline,” Dare said in a statement. “We are so proud of you all players and coaches, and also happy with the results so far. We are solidly behind you. However, this is not the time to rest on your oars. The journey ahead of you is a long one.“Go all out on Saturday, win the WAFU U-20 trophy, and then we will begin to prepare for the U-20 AFCON next year and be among the four African representatives at the World Cup proper.”

The Flying Eagles, who had earlier beaten the defending champion Ghana 2-0 and drew 2-2 with Burkina Faso, will face the Benin Republic in Saturday’s final in Niamey.
